My Buying Guides on $100 Deep Freezer
Why I Look for a $100 Deep Freezer
When I shop for a deep freezer on a budget, I focus on getting the best value for my money. A $100 deep freezer usually means I need to be realistic about size, features, and brand name. I look for a freezer that can handle my everyday storage needs without costing too much upfront.
What Size Works Best for Me
I always start by thinking about capacity. If I only need extra space for frozen meals, meat, or leftovers, a compact model is usually enough. If I want to store bulk groceries or larger items, I try to find the biggest capacity I can get within my budget. I make sure the size fits my kitchen, garage, or apartment space too.
My Must-Have Features
Even on a tight budget, I still look for a few important features. I prefer a freezer with adjustable temperature control, a removable storage basket, and a drain plug for easier cleaning. If I can find a model with a power indicator light or a lid that seals tightly, that is a big plus for me.
Energy Efficiency Matters to Me
I pay attention to energy use because a cheap freezer should not become expensive to run. I look for models that are designed to save electricity and keep food frozen without working too hard. In my experience, a more efficient freezer helps me save money over time.
How I Check Build Quality
Since I am buying at a lower price point, I inspect the build quality carefully. I want a sturdy lid, solid hinges, and a dependable interior lining. I also read reviews to see if other buyers mention noise, cooling problems, or weak parts. That helps me avoid a bad purchase.
Where I Usually Find the Best Deals
I compare prices from online stores, local appliance shops, warehouse sales, and clearance sections. Sometimes I find better value in refurbished or open-box units, as long as they still come with a warranty. I always compare shipping costs too, because that can change the final price a lot.
My Tips for Buying Smart
I never rush into a purchase just because the price looks low. I check the measurements, warranty, return policy, and customer reviews before I buy. I also think about whether I need a chest freezer or an upright freezer, since each style works differently for storage and access.
